Sun Stuns Serena in Beijing - Part I   9/23/2005

Sun Stuns Serena in Beijing - Part I ||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||| <br> The reign has ended for Serena Williams at the China Open. The defending champion and No.4 seed was ousted in her first match of the week in Beijing, losing to No.127-ranked wild card Sun Tiantian, 62 76(4). With the shocking win, Sun moves into only her ...

Global warming or global cooling?   9/11/2005

The oceans play a vital and pivotal role in the distribution of life sustaining water throughout our planet. 86% of the evaporation that occurs on earth is over the oceans. The oceans are the planets largest reservoir of water transferring huge amounts of water around the hydrological cycle. In fact the oceans “dominate the hydrological cycle, for they contain 97% of the global water ...
